What Is a Car Locksmith?

A car locksmith, also called an automotive locksmith, is a specialized professional trained to manage all types of concerns related to vehicle locks and keys. These experts can assist with a range of services, from key duplication and lock rekeying to transponder key programming and ignition repair. Car locksmith professionals are geared up with the tools and knowledge to manage modern-day car security systems, including those with sophisticated innovation like keyless entry and anti-theft devices.

Why You Might Need a Car Locksmith

There are numerous circumstances where the services of a car locksmith may be required:

  1. Lockout: If you've locked yourself out of your car, a locksmith can quickly and efficiently open your vehicle without causing damage.
  2. Key Duplication: If you need an extra set of keys or your existing keys are worn, a car locksmith can make top quality duplicates.
  3. Transponder Key Programming: Modern lorries typically come with transponder keys that require programming to match the car's distinct recognition code. A professional locksmith can manage this task.
  4. Lock Repair or Replacement: If your car lock is broken or malfunctioning, a locksmith can repair or replace it.
  5. Ignition Repair: Issues with the ignition can avoid your car from starting. A car locksmith can identify and repair these issues.
  6. Car Security Systems: If you're looking to enhance your car's security with extra locks or an alarm system, a car locksmith can set up and configure these for you.

What to Expect from a Car Locksmith Service

When you call a car locksmith, the procedure typically includes the following actions:

  1. Initial Contact:

    • Call or Book Online: Contact the locksmith through their phone number or site. Provide them with your area and the nature of the issue.
    • Price quote: Most locksmith professionals will provide you a quote over the phone. Ensure you comprehend the expense before they get here.
  2. On-Site Service:

    • Verification: The locksmith will request recognition to validate that you are the owner of the vehicle. This is a standard security measure.
    • Assessment: They will assess the problem and identify the best course of action.
    • Service Execution: Depending on the issue, the locksmith might open your car, make a brand-new key, rekey your locks, or carry out other essential jobs.
    • Checking: After the service is finished, the locksmith will evaluate the locks and keys to guarantee whatever is working properly.
    • Payment: Payment is normally made at the end of the service. Some locksmiths accept cash, while others might take credit cards or mobile payments.

Frequently Asked Questions About Car Locksmiths

Q: How much does a car locksmith usually cost?A: The cost of a car locksmith service can vary based upon the specific task, the make and design of your car, and the area. Typically, unlocking a car can range from ₤ 30 to ₤ 100, while making a new key can cost in between ₤ 50 and ₤ 150. More complicated jobs like transponder key programming or lock replacement can be more pricey.

Q: Can a car locksmith make a brand-new key without the original?A: Yes, an expert car locksmith can make a brand-new key even if you don't have the initial. However, this procedure may require extra time and tools, and it can be more costly than duplicating an existing key.

Q: How long does it consider a car locksmith to get here?A: The reaction time can vary. In city areas, it may take 30 minutes to an hour. In more remote locations, the wait time can be longer. Many locksmith professionals offer 24/7 emergency situation services.

Q: Can a car locksmith program a transponder key?A: Yes, car locksmiths who are trained in modern automotive technology can program transponder keys. This involves syncing the key's unique code with your car's onboard computer system.

Q: Do car locksmiths use mobile services?A: Yes, numerous car locksmith professionals offer mobile services, allowing them to come to your location, whether it's your home, office, or the side of the roadway.

Tools and Technology Used by Car Locksmiths

Car locksmiths use a variety of tools and technologies to perform their services:

  • Lock Picks and Decoders: For traditional lockout assistance and lock manipulation.
  • Key Cutting Machines: To replicate keys precisely.
  • Transponder Key Programmers: To program transponder keys to your car's specific code.
  • Diagnostic Scanners: To determine concerns with your car's electronic systems.
  • Drilling Equipment: For situations where locks are severely damaged and require to be drilled out.
